Duties and Responsibilities :
Oversee operational and financial management of 10-20 apartment communities in an assigned geographic regionMaintain detailed knowledge of competitive properties and market knowledge of all assets in portfolioAssist in pitching business to prospective new clientsPrepare annual budgets, including capital expenditure budgets, or review and authorize budgets submitted by othersPrepare monthly owner’s reports and quarterly financial reviewsCreate value for clients through meeting NOI and revenue goalsEnsure occupancy targets are achieved through leasing and resident retentionContribute to creation of and ensure execution of marketing plans for communities within assigned portfolioOversee execution of proactive and timely reputation management strategies via social media – ratings, reviews, responsesPerform regular property inspections to ensure buildings are up to government and environmental regulationsOversee planning and construction of tenant improvements and interior designEnsure operational execution yields consistently strong resident satisfaction survey resultsActively participate in the hiring processLeverage a succession plan to anticipate needs and develop talentManage performance issues in a timely and effective mannerEnsure employee compliance with the Washington State Residential Landlord & Tenant ActQualifications - This position carries supervisory responsibilities.
